Yotel Glasgow hotel features a shared lounge and a bowling alley and sits near a train station. All guests can enjoy Wi-Fi in public areas and access to a fitness studio.
Location
A transport museum is 3 km from this hotel and the Kelvingrove Art Gallery and Museum is a 25-minute walk away. The 4-star hotel is nestled right in the centre of Glasgow. The Yotel is also a few moments from a gas-lit residence and Central bus station is about 100 metres away.
This property is a 5-minute walk from St Enoch tube station and a short way from Buchanan Street.
Rooms
The smoke-free hotel welcomes guests to 257 rooms complete with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as comforts like ironing equipment and air conditioning. Also, the accommodation features carpet flooring. Bathrooms are appointed with a separate toilet and a shower along with a hair dryer and bath sheets.
Eat & Drink
Lunch is served in the onsite restaurant Vega. Yotel Glasgow hotel invites guests to the lounge bar to relax with a drink. There is a barbecue serving Brazilian food about 500 metres away.
Leisure & Business
This Glasgow hotel goes the extra mile to provide guests with fitness classes to help them stay fit.
